    Agreed, that's the plain and simple fact for nearly every deal during that 2015-2016 selloff period.
    Personally, the Cueto situation always bothered me the most. As you’ll recall it was widely believed Reds were trying to remain credible through the Cincy ASG. So they held Cueto — who couldn’t realistically gain trade value in 2015 after that magnificent 2014 season. Instead he lost value and this incredible asset was traded for a “pretty good” package.

    Sorry it didn’t work out for Finnegan (so far), but that one still stings.

    The KC package, including Finnegan, was good. But Reds should have traded Cueto in the 2014 off-season after his 243 inning, Cy Young runner up, 20-win, healthy, magnificent season.

    Cueto was retained deep into 2015, perhaps because of the All Star Game in Cincy, He had some elbow concerns that season which couldn’t have helped his trade value. The package received from KC was good, but Cueto should have brought a great return.

    Reds knew Cueto was leaving, he was an impending FA, they were heading toward a rebuild. Finnegan was a good young pitcher but - many thought ultimately a reliever, and eventually injuries hurt him.
    To me, that's the biggest factor. He wasn't going to be a Red moving forward anyway...Reds weren't going to pay him what he could demand.

    Quantity over quality seemed to be the mantra of the Reds during the rebuild. It is as if they didn't trust their evaluations and wanted the largest package of prospects they could land rather than the package with the best prospect. It's pretty much akin to their practice of throwing their own prospects against the wall at the major league level to see who might stick because they weren't sure who was ready.

    I sure hope those days are long gone.
